You shouldn't just assume that you'll be able to do a loft conversion, as not all lofts in Troon are suitable. Calling an expert in to guarantee your loft can in fact be converted ought to be one of your first steps. The most critical thing is the height of the loft space because you require a height of at least 2.2m to successfully do a loft conversion. Calculating the height of your loft doesn't need an expert, the truth is you can do this yourself using little more than a measuring tape and a loft ladder. An additional important issue is the kind of roof which you've got on your house, trussed roofs are more costly to convert than those that have rafters.

History of Loft Conversion

Whilst the concept of a loft conversion might seem like very "British", the early loft conversions and maybe the initial ideas for converting lofts began in nineteen sixties America. The exact location for this building craze was the Soho district of New York, where cool, new living areas were built by artists and designers in the upper parts of delapidated industrial structures. The truth was that these areas and structures weren't allotted for this purpose, and therefore were mainly illegal in the day. It wasn't until the early 1970's that New York finally legalized this practise, and consequently some other areas of the city including Greenwich Village, Chelsea, Manhattan and Tribeca joined the revolution, and "loft living" was popular for the wealthy, young and talented. In Britain loft conversion is an appealing proposition especially in huge urban centres such as Birmingham, Manchester, London and Leeds, where building land is pricey and any means by which to generate extra liveable space without having to extend the building's footprint is welcomed. Mansard Loft Conversions Troon
The Mansard sort of doing a loft conversion first saw the light of day sometime in the Seventeenth Century by a French architect by the name of Mansart. He thought it would be a bit of a space saving method which would yield a substantial degree of extra living area in an unused area. This style of attic conversion is only employed on roof which are pitched and additional space is produced by raising one wall (as a rule in the rear of the property) and then leveling out that area of the roof, and so creating an almost box shape. The finished angle of the raised wall is required to be on no less than a 72 degree slant. It's normally the situation that the wall to be lifted is shared with a neighbour (especially with houses that are terraced), which means that you will need the cooperation of your immediate neighbour - yet another worry if you are not the best of pals!

Conversion Planning Permission

Loft Conversion Planning Permission Troon: Though a few conditions are placed on this sort of venture, local authority planning permission isn't generally needed for loft conversions. Specified limitations must not be exceeded if your roof space needs changing, if they are then you'll have to apply for planning permission. Most of the stipulations which must be satisfied are: materials utilised in construction have to match existing materials, raised platforms, balconies and verandas aren't permitted, a max of 40 cubic metres added space for terraced houses and 50 cubic metres for detached/semi-detached houses, existing exterior walls can't be overhung by any roof extension, obscured glass is essential on side-facing windows, the highest part of the existing roof structure mustn't be exceeded by an extension, as observed from the road no roof extension should exceed the plane of the current roof slope. In addition it should be mentioned that these guidelines apply to houses and not to maisonettes, converted houses, flats or other structures. For those that reside in specific areas there could be different rules where special planning conditions are imposed and development is restricted. To find out what conditions apply to your house, you must consult with your planning department.
